KPIs / Success Metrics


Planning & Alignment

  • Roadmap–Strategy Alignment (%): % of roadmap initiatives directly tied to strategic objectives.
  • Stakeholder Satisfaction with Roadmap: Survey-based measure (e.g., PMs, leadership, customers).
  • Prioritization Accuracy: % of high-priority roadmap items that show positive business impact post-launch.


Execution

  • Roadmap Delivery Rate: % of planned features delivered in the intended release timeframe.
  • Schedule Variance: Difference between planned and actual delivery dates (avg days or %).
  • Roadmap Predictability: Ratio of committed vs. delivered features over time.
  • Cross-Team Dependency Resolution Time: Avg time to resolve blocking issues between teams.


Change Management

  • Roadmap Volatility: % of roadmap items added, removed, or significantly changed per quarter.
  • Change Approval Lead Time: Avg time from change request to approval on roadmap.


Feature Validation KPIs

Adoption & Usage

  • Feature Adoption Rate: % of active users using the new feature within a given period.
  • Time to Adoption: Avg days until 50% of target users adopt the feature.
  • Feature Retention Rate: % of users who continue using the feature after 30/60/90 days.


User Experience & Feedback

  • Feature Satisfaction Score (FSAT): User feedback score on a per-feature basis.
  • Net Promoter Score (NPS) Change Post-Release: Impact of new features on NPS trend.
  • Support Tickets per Feature: Number of bug or issue reports per new feature release.


Performance & Quality

  • Bug Rate Post-Release: # of defects reported within first X days after deployment
  • Rollback Frequency: % of features needing rollback or hotfix post-release.
  • Mean Time to Resolve (MTTR): Avg time to fix critical post-release issues.


Business Impact

  • Feature ROI: (Feature-attributed revenue – development cost) / development cost.
  • Conversion/Uplift Rate: % improvement in key conversion or engagement metric post-feature release.
  • Churn Reduction Impact: % reduction in churn attributed to new feature.


Combined Strategic KPIs

  • If the product’s mission is to bridge roadmap planning with validation, these aggregate both sides:
  • Validated Feature Ratio: % of delivered features that met predefined success criteria (usage, satisfaction, ROI).
  • Time from Idea to Validation: Avg duration from roadmap inclusion to validation of impact.
  • Roadmap Accuracy Index: Weighted measure of how well planned features met business goals post-launch.
  • Feedback-to-Roadmap Cycle Time: Avg time between user feedback and a validated roadmap update.
